Does your baby smell like maple syrup? Let's learn about this dangerous disease (Maple Syrup Urine Disease)

Does your baby smell like maple syrup? Let's learn about this dangerous disease (Maple Syrup Urine Disease)

Does your newborn's body or urine smell strangely sweet, like maple syrup? You might think it's normal. But it could be a sign of a serious condition that should never be ignored and requires immediate medical attention. This condition is called maple syrup urine disease, or MSUD for short. Today, we'll talk about it in a simple, easy-to-understand way.

What exactly is maple syrup urine disease (MSUD)?

Simply put, Maple Syrup Urine Disease (MSUD) is a genetic condition that is present at birth, lasts a lifetime, and can be life-threatening if not treated properly. It is a metabolic disorder. A metabolic disorder may sound complicated to you. But it is very simple. It means that there is a problem in the process by which our body converts the food we eat into energy.

In MSUD, our bodies are unable to properly break down certain amino acids, the building blocks of protein, and convert them into energy. This problem occurs with three amino acids in particular:

  • Leucine
  • Isoleucine
  • Valine

In people born with MSUD, these three amino acids are not broken down properly in the body, so they accumulate in the body to toxic levels. This toxic state is the main symptom of the disease, which is the smell of maple syrup or burnt sugar in the urine , earwax, and sweat.

If you notice any of these symptoms in your baby, seek medical attention immediately. If not treated promptly, MSUD can lead to serious complications, such as stunted growth, intellectual disability, and even death.

What are the main types of MSUD?

MSUD can be divided into four main types. Not all types are the same. Some are very severe, while others are a little less severe.

Disease type Description
Classic MSUD This is the most severe and common type of MSUD. Symptoms usually appear within the first three days after birth.
Intermediate MSUD This type is less severe than the classic type. Symptoms usually appear between the ages of 5 months and 7 years.
Intermittent MSUD Children with this type develop normally, but symptoms suddenly appear when the body is exposed to an infection or when there is mental stress.
Thiamine-responsive MSUD This is a very special type. These patients respond well to treatment with high doses of vitamin B1 (thiamine). Along with that, dietary control is also necessary.

Is this disease common?

No. MSUD is a very rare disease . Worldwide, it affects only about one in 185,000 babies born.

However, this disease is more common among some ethnic groups. This is especially common among people from the same family or lineage, that is, people who marry close relatives. This is because the gene that causes this disease is more prevalent in those communities.

What are the symptoms of MSUD? ​​How to recognize an emergency?

It is very important to be aware of the symptoms because it helps to start treatment quickly.

Imagine a mother with a newborn baby who notices a strange, sweet smell when changing her baby's diaper or cuddling her. At first, you might not pay attention to it. But after two or three days, the baby can't even drink milk, cries all the time, and seems lethargic. This is when you need to quickly think that this is not normal.

If left untreated, this condition can progress to a metabolic crisis, a very dangerous emergency.

Early symptoms Symptoms of a Metabolic Crisis
A sweet smell coming from urine , sweat, or earwax. Abnormal muscle contractions (the baby's head, neck, and spine bend backward).
Lethargy, drowsiness, and lifelessness. Seizures or convulsions (uncontrollable body movements).
Constant crying and restlessness. Vomiting.
Refusal to eat (not drinking milk). Coma.

Attention: A metabolic crisis is a life-threatening condition. If you see these signs, you should immediately take your child to a hospital's emergency department (ETU) .

Even in children and adults diagnosed with MSUD, this type of metabolic crisis can be triggered by something like an infection, an accident, or severe stress. So it's important to always be aware of this.

Why does this disease occur?

MSUD is caused by a genetic mutation , which is inherited from parents to children.

Simply put, our bodies need a special type of enzyme to break down the amino acids we talked about earlier: leucine, isoleucine, and valine. Our genes instruct us to make these enzymes.

A person with MSUD has a mutation, or defect, in these genes that provide instructions. This causes:

  • The relevant enzyme may not be produced at all in the body.
  • Or, not enough enzymes may be produced .
  • Sometimes, even though enzymes are produced, they may not function properly .

Whatever the reason, what ultimately happens is that those three amino acids accumulate in the body and reach toxic levels.

How is this disease inherited?

This is inherited in an autosomal recessive pattern . This sounds like a complicated word, doesn't it? Let's keep it simple.

For a child to develop this disease, both the mother and father must be carriers of the defective gene. A carrier means that the person has both a good copy and a defective copy of the gene in their body. Carriers do not develop this disease. This is because the good copy of the gene makes the necessary enzyme.

However, if both parents are carriers, the child may inherit the defective gene from both the mother and the father. Only if both defective genes are inherited will the child develop MSUD.

What are the possible complications of this disease?

Toxins that accumulate in the body can damage several of our organ systems. If left untreated or not managed properly, the following complications can occur:

  • Brain damage , nervous system problems, and developmental delays.
  • Increased risk of mental health conditions such as attention deficit hyperactivity disorder (ADHD), anxiety, and depression.
  • Decreased bone mass ( osteoporosis ), which can cause bones to break easily.
  • Inflammation of the pancreas ( pancreatitis ), especially when there is a metabolic crisis.
  • Chronic headaches caused by increased pressure in the skull.
  • Movement disorders such as tremors and uncontrolled muscle contractions.
  • Coma and even death can occur due to infection, stress, or poor diet.

How to diagnose the disease? (Diagnosis)

Classic MSUD is usually diagnosed during newborn screenings, which are blood tests.

Additionally, tests can be done during pregnancy to determine if the baby has the disease. This can be done by taking a small sample of the placenta ( chorionic villus sampling ) or testing the amniotic fluid around the baby ( amniocentesis ).

Children with other types of MSUD may not show symptoms in early childhood. Symptoms may not appear until several years later. At that time, the doctor will confirm the disease through blood tests and genetic testing . Also, the special sweet smell coming from the child's body is a big clue to the disease.

What are the treatments for MSUD?

Although there is no cure for MSUD, it can be managed well and a normal life can be achieved. Treatment has two main goals:

1. Controlling the levels of those three amino acids in the body.

2. Provide emergency treatment if a metabolic crisis occurs.

1. Diet

This is the most important part of managing MSUD. The patient has to follow a very strict diet for the rest of their life. That means limiting protein-rich foods. Because those three problematic amino acids are found in protein.

Main foods to limit
Meat products Beef, pork, chicken, fish.
Dairy products Milk, cheese, eggs.
Legumes Cashews, peanuts, chickpeas, beans, lentils.

A newborn baby is given a special type of milk powder that does not contain these three amino acids, but contains all the other nutrients.

It is essential to work with a nutritionist to develop a safe and healthy diet plan that is appropriate for each patient.

2. Constant monitoring

A patient with MSUD must be under medical supervision for the rest of their life. Blood and urine tests are performed regularly to check the amino acid levels in the body. The diet is adjusted based on the results.

3. Emergency treatment for metabolic crises

If you develop symptoms of metabolic crisis, you should be hospitalized immediately. At the hospital, the medical team may provide the following treatments:

  • Amino acid levels are controlled by administering intravenous (IV) glucose and insulin.
  • Necessary, but harmless, nutrients are given to the body through a nasogastric tube or IV.
  • Hemodialysis is performed to remove toxic substances from the blood.
  • Complications such as brain swelling are regularly checked and necessary treatment is provided.

Can this disease be cured with a liver transplant?

Yes. This is the best hope for MSUD patients. A liver transplant can successfully cure classic MSUD.

The reason for this is that the enzyme that breaks down the problematic amino acids is produced mainly by the liver. So when a healthy liver is transplanted, that liver produces the necessary enzyme. After that, the patient can live a normal life without any dietary restrictions or symptoms.

However, a liver transplant is a major operation. It has risks. It also requires lifelong immunosuppressants to prevent the body from rejecting the new liver. However, this method has brought many people better results than living with MSUD.

Is there a way to prevent this disease?

Because MSUD is a genetic disease, it cannot be completely prevented. However, the risk of a child inheriting the disease can be reduced.

If someone in your family has MSUD, it is important to talk to your doctor about it before you have a baby. You and your partner can get a genetic test to see if you are carriers. If you are both carriers, you can talk to a genetic counselor about your risk of passing the disease on to your child and what steps you can take to prevent it.
